General Electric IC694MDL655 | Reliable Automation Component for Mission-Critical I/O

Field Application & Operational Analysis

From the perspective of a Site Reliability Engineer managing high-availability production infrastructure, the IC694MDL655 stands as a cornerstone discrete input module within GE Fanuc RX3i PACSystems architectures. Its 32-channel DC input capacity directly elevates system availability by consolidating high-density signal acquisition into a single backplane slot — reducing inter-module latency and simplifying fault isolation during unplanned outages. The IC694MDL655 integrates seamlessly into existing RX3i racks, enabling process optimization without requiring controller replacement or extensive rewiring, making it a preferred choice for Operational Excellence programs across manufacturing and energy sectors.

Engineered to withstand the rigors of industrial field environments, this module operates reliably across a 10-30 VDC input range with 500 VAC optical isolation between field and logic circuits — a critical safeguard against ground loops and transient voltage spikes common in heavy-industry installations. During commissioning, SREs should verify backplane power budget headroom (module draws 350 mW), use shielded twisted-pair field wiring in high-EMI zones, and confirm input filter timing settings match the scan cycle requirements of the host CPU. Removable terminal blocks further streamline maintenance windows by allowing wiring harness pre-assembly and rapid swap without disturbing adjacent modules.

Key Operational Features

32-Channel High-Density Input: Maximizes rack utilization — one slot replaces multiple lower-density modules, reducing system footprint and wiring complexity.
Sinking/Sourcing Flexibility: Software-configurable input polarity supports both NPN and PNP field devices without hardware modification — critical for System Integration across mixed-vendor sensor environments.
500 VAC Optical Isolation: Galvanic separation between field and logic circuits ensures High Availability by protecting the CPU backplane from field-side electrical faults.
1 ms Configurable Input Filter: Rapid event detection supports high-speed interlock and safety circuit monitoring with deterministic response timing.
Individual Channel LED Diagnostics: 32 dedicated status LEDs plus a module-OK indicator enable rapid visual fault localization — reducing MTTR in live production environments.
Hot-Swap Capable: Supports module replacement under power (with appropriate CPU configuration), enabling Redundancy strategies and minimizing planned maintenance downtime.
Wide Environmental Tolerance: Rated 0°C to 60°C operating, 5-95% RH non-condensing; conformal coating option available for corrosive or high-humidity process areas.

Comprehensive Data Sheet

Attribute Technical Data
Model Number IC694MDL655
Manufacturer General Electric (GE Fanuc)
Product Family RX3i PACSystems Series
Module Type 32-Point Discrete DC Input
Input Channels 32
Input Voltage Range 10-30 VDC nominal (24 VDC typical)
Input Current per Point 7 mA @ 24 VDC
Input Configuration Sinking / Sourcing (software selectable)
Logic ON Threshold 15 VDC
Logic OFF Threshold 5 VDC
Input Impedance 3.3 kΩ typical
Response / Filter Time 1 ms typical (configurable)
Isolation Voltage 500 VAC optical (field-to-logic)
Backplane Power Draw 350 mW
Operating Temperature 0°C to 60°C (32°F to 140°F)
Storage Temperature -40°C to 85°C (-40°F to 185°F)
Relative Humidity 5% to 95% non-condensing
Mounting RX3i Backplane Slot (any slot)
LED Indicators 32 — Input Status + 1 — Module OK
Terminal Block Removable screw-type
Conformal Coating Available (harsh environment option)
Certifications UL, CE, CSA, RoHS
Country of Origin United States

Engineering Support & FAQ

Q1: What are the step-by-step installation requirements for the IC694MDL655 in an existing RX3i rack?
A: Power down the rack (or confirm hot-swap is enabled in your CPU configuration). Insert the IC694MDL655 into any available backplane slot. Connect field wiring to the removable terminal block — verify sinking/sourcing polarity matches your field devices. Re-energize the rack; the CPU will auto-detect the module. Configure input filter times and I/O mapping in your programming software (Proficy Machine Edition or equivalent). Verify all 32 channel LEDs reflect correct field device states before returning to production.

Q2: Which firmware versions and CPU models are compatible with the IC694MDL655?
A: The IC694MDL655 is compatible with all RX3i CPU modules (IC695CPE302, IC695CPE305, IC695CPE310, IC695CPE330, IC695CPE400) running firmware version 3.50 and above. It is also backward-compatible with RX7i rack configurations. Always verify your Proficy Machine Edition version supports the target CPU firmware to avoid I/O configuration mismatches.

Q3: Can the IC694MDL655 be used in safety-rated (SIL) applications?
A: The standard IC694MDL655 is not SIL-certified for use as a primary safety function element. However, it is widely deployed to monitor the output states of certified safety relays and emergency stop circuits as a diagnostic input — providing status visibility to the standard control program without being part of the safety function itself. For SIL-rated discrete input requirements, consult GE’s PACSystems Safety product line.

Q5: How do I calculate whether my RX3i power supply can support an additional IC694MDL655?
A: Sum the backplane power consumption of all installed modules (CPU, I/O, communication). The IC694MDL655 adds 350 mW to the backplane load. Ensure your power supply’s rated backplane output capacity exceeds total module demand by a minimum 20% margin. For example, an IC694PWR331 (40W backplane output) can support approximately 114 W of module load at 80% utilization — well within typical multi-module configurations.

Q6: Is conformal coating required for my application environment?
A: Conformal coating is recommended for installations in environments with elevated humidity (>85% RH sustained), condensation risk, airborne corrosive agents (H , SO , chlorine), or heavy particulate contamination. Standard IC694MDL655 units are suitable for typical industrial environments meeting IEC 60068-2 Class 3C1 chemical conditions. Specify the conformal-coated variant at time of order for harsh-environment deployments.
